Ever heard of “Kids Free San Diego”?

During the entire month of October, more than 100 San Diego hotels, restaurants, attractions, museums, tours and transportation companies offer families the opportunity to unwind in San Diego without having to worry about breaking the bank.

With world-class family attractions, a rich arts and culture scene, delicious Cali-Baja cuisine and popular activities like whale watching, golfing, surfing and kayaking, San Diego is constantly rated a top family destination.

In October, after the summer beach crowds diminish, visitors to San Diego can relish in the region’s sunny weather and warm temperatures and enjoy a number of fun-filled fall activities at reduced prices.

San Diego Zoo Entrance

Highlights include free admission for kids 12 and under to the San Diego Zoo, Aquatica San Diego, San Diego National History Museum, plus loads of other unique cultural and arts venues.

Not to mention a plethora of ‘kids eat free’ at many not-to-be-missed local restaurants, plus hotel deals, including a very cool sleep-over package for kids under 12 at the Pendry.
